CNC turning centers, also referred to as lathes, are perfect for generating axially symmetric parts with excellent dimensional accuracy. These machines rotate a workpiece even though numerous cutting tools condition the material.

Turning is a elementary machining technique that involves rotating a workpiece whilst a cutting tool eliminates material to make cylindrical parts. This process is often used to make parts including shafts, valves, and also other rotational components.
